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s) about Robot Vacuum Cleaners:

Q1: Are robot vacuum worth the financial investment?

A: For numerous, yes. Robot vacuums use significant convenience by automating a recurring task. They are exceptional for everyday upkeep cleaning, keeping floors consistently tidier and minimizing the requirement for regular manual vacuuming.

Q2: How often should I run my robot vacuum?

A: It depends upon your requirements and lifestyle. Daily cleaning is perfect for high-traffic areas or homes with family pets. For less busy families, running it a couple of times a week might be sufficient. Scheduling is a terrific function to automate this procedure.

Q3: Can a robot vacuum entirely change a traditional vacuum?

A: While robot vacuums are excellent for day-to-day surface area cleaning, they might not entirely change a standard vacuum cleaner for deep cleaning tasks, reaching tight corners, or cleaning upholstery. They are best deemed an enhance to, rather than a complete replacement for, traditional vacuuming.

Q4: Do robot vacuums work well on dark carpets?

A: Some older or less advanced robot vacuums can have trouble detecting dark carpets, in some cases mistaking them for ledges and avoiding them. Nevertheless, numerous contemporary models are created to navigate dark surface areas successfully. Check product requirements and evaluations if you have dark carpets.

Q5: How long do robot vacuum cleaners generally last?

A: The life-span of a robot vacuum depends on aspects like brand name quality, frequency of usage, and upkeep. Normally, a properly maintained robot vacuum can last for a number of years, typically varying from 3 to 7 years. Battery life may deteriorate over time and require replacement ultimately.
